Síkfeszültségben refers to a state of stress in a material where the stress components acting perpendicular to a specific plane are zero. This concept is fundamental in the field of solid mechanics and is used to simplify the analysis of stress states. In a general three-dimensional stress state, there are three principal stresses acting on mutually perpendicular planes. However, in a state of síkfeszültségben, one of these principal stresses is zero, meaning there is no stress acting normal to a particular plane. This effectively reduces the problem to a two-dimensional stress analysis.
